驾驶员视线估计方法综述

摘    要:研究基于计算机视觉的视线估计方法,对驾驶员视线估计的暨有研究成果加以回顾与评述,并对可能的发展趋势进行分析。主要针对3类基于计算机视觉的方法展开论述:基于PCCR(Pupil Center Corneal Reflection)技术的视线估计方法;基于AAM模型(Active Appearance Model)的视线估计方法;基于统计模式识别的视线估计方法。总体上讲各种技术都是基于图像传感器的,很难突破图像传感器特有的鲁棒性不强、难以适应全天候工作要求的缺点,但各种技术有着各自的特点,因此也很难用统一的标准去衡量各种监测技术的优劣。本文给出了几种有代表性系统的性能比较。
